The Vivo Y500 Pro is a rumored upcoming Android smartphone expected to bring high-end features to the mid-premium segment. It carries a sleek design and rugged protection with IP68/IP69+ certification, making it dustproof, water-resistant, and drop-resistant up to 1.7 meters. Its body measures 160.2 x 74.5 x 7.8 mm and weighs 198 grams, giving a good blend of elegance and durability.
Design and Display
Vivo equips the Y500 Pro with a stunning 6.67-inch AMOLED display supporting 1 billion colors, a smooth 120Hz refresh rate, 3840Hz PWM dimming, and an incredible 5000 nits peak brightness. With a resolution of 1260 x 2800 pixels and Diamond Shield Glass protection along with an anti-reflective coating, it is made for premium viewing with durability in mind.
Performance and Software
Running Android 16 with OriginOS 6, the Vivo Y500 Pro is expected to offer a seamless, intuitive, and customizable experience. It is powered by the Mediatek Dimensity 7400 chipset based on a 4nm process. The octa-core CPU combines Cortex-A78 and Cortex-A55 cores for power efficiency and performance, while the Mali-G615 MC2 GPU handles gaming and graphic tasks with ease.
It offers two internal storage options: 256GB or 512GB, both paired with 12GB RAM. While it does not support a memory card, the UFS storage ensures high-speed data access and smooth multitasking.
Camera Capabilities
Photography enthusiasts are likely to be impressed by its 200MP main rear camera with PDAF and OIS, capturing sharp, detailed images even in challenging lighting. It is supported by an auxiliary lens, and features like HDR and panorama add versatility. Video recording supports up to 4K with gyro-EIS. The 32MP front camera also offers 4K video support, ideal for vloggers and selfie lovers.
Battery and Charging
One standout feature of the Vivo Y500 Pro is its massive 7000 mAh silicon-carbon Li-Ion battery, designed for extended usage. It supports 90W fast wired charging and reverse wired charging, making it both long-lasting and convenient.
Connectivity and Audio
The device supports GSM, CDMA, HSPA, LTE, and 5G networks. Connectivity features include Wi-Fi 6, Bluetooth 5.4, GPS, GLONASS, GALILEO, QZSS, BDS, NFC, and USB Type-C 2.0 with OTG support. Though it lacks a 3.5mm headphone jack, it offers stereo speakers, 24-bit/192kHz Hi-Res audio, Hi-Res Wireless, and 3D Panoramic Audio for an immersive sound experience.
Sensors and Extra Features
The Vivo Y500 Pro features an under-display optical fingerprint sensor along with other essential sensors like accelerometer, proximity, compass, and gyro. It is expected to launch in multiple color options, including Black, Green, Pink, and Gold, with model number V2516A.
